Sunday August 07, 2011
Today, skies will be mostly sunny, with some mid to high level cloudiness. Winds will be from the ESE, at 15 to 20 mph , this morning; shifting to ENE this afternoon and increasing in strength to 20 to 25 mph. The seas will be moderate to large, at 2 to 4 feet in height or higher, especially after 3:00 pm this afternoon. Expect these weather conditions for most of this week.
The air temperatures will be in the 80s to the mid 90s (F) or 27 to 32 (C). The heat index remains at 101F or 38C. At depth, ocean water temperatures are about 82F to 84F or 28C to 29C . Visibility is generally 60 to 80 feet.

The Tropical Weather Outlook
The remnants of Emily have reformed into a tropical depression over the Bahamas. It is moving N at 10 mph and is forecast to turn NE away from Florida and the East Coast of the USA.
Elsewhere, tropical storm formation is not expected for the next 24 hours.
